Senior Tories have urged Rishi Sunak to back onshore renewable energy rather than off-shore oil and gas after a poll showed strong support for alternative power sources among Conservative voters.


A survey on behalf of the Conservative Environment Network (CEN) revealed that 82 per cent of people want to see more renewable energy in the UK, including 77 per cent of Tory voters at the 2019 election, and 81 per cent who plan to vote for the party next time.
